5 gentle ways to stay active for your well-being and pelvic health

Moving every day is essential for staying fit and maintaining good health. But did you know that some gentle activities can also reduce pelvic pain and improve internal mobility?

Discover our 5 gentle ways to stay active , easy to integrate into your daily routine.

1. Yoga: reducing stress and relieving pelvic pain

Yoga combines deep breathing, gentle postures, and relaxation. Certain positions help release tension in the pelvic area and improve the flexibility of internal organs.

Benefits of yoga for the pelvis:

Reduces stress and tension

Improves balance and flexibility

Relieves pelvic pain

2. Pilates: strengthening the pelvic floor and improving internal mobility

Pilates targets the deep muscles, including the pelvic floor and abdominal muscles. By strengthening this area, it supports the internal organs and improves their mobility.

Benefits of Pilates:

Pelvic floor strengthening

Improved posture

Reduction of pelvic discomfort

3. Active walking: a simple and effective solution

Brisk walking is accessible to everyone and requires no equipment. It promotes blood circulation and reduces tension in the pelvic area.

Benefits of brisk walking:

Stimulates circulation

Boosts energy and mood

Improves mobility without impact

4. Swimming: lightness and relaxation

Swimming is perfect for working the whole body without putting pressure on the joints. The water lightens the pelvis and allows internal organs to move freely.

Benefits of swimming:

Complete muscle workout

Improves breathing

Relieves pelvic pressure


5. Free dance: moving while having fun

Free dancing stimulates circulation and mobilizes the pelvis while providing genuine enjoyment. It's an excellent way to free yourself physically and emotionally.

Benefits of free dance:

Release the tensions

Improves coordination

Mobilizes internal organs

These gentle ways of staying active help maintain your overall health, reduce pelvic pain, and promote internal mobility.
